TENNIS IN AMERICA

FOREST HILLS TOURNAMENT PERRY DEFEATS GULLEY Press Association—By Telegraph—Copyright NEW YORK, September 9. At the Forest Hills lawn tennis tournament Perry defeated Gulley (California), 6-3, 6-2, 6-1. It Vas an uninteresting match, the American, despite a cannon-ball service and occasional glimpses of top-flight lawn tennis, being unable tq withstand the Englishman’s all-round accuracy and sound play. Grant defeated Van Ryn, 3-6, 8-6, 6-3.

Miss Marble defeated Miss Wheeler (California), 6-2, 11-9. Miss Stammers defeated Miss Babcock, 7-5, 4-6, 6-4.
